International Selkirk Loop information and facts
Highlights and features:
The International Selkirk Loop is the only place to find old growth forests of pine and spruce trees which are home to the greatest diversity of wildlife in the lower 48 states! Moose and Elk are seen year round as they come to drink from the many lakes that the loop skirts round. This amazing scenic drive is an outdoor lovers dream come true. Bring a camera, whatever you do!
Location of International Selkirk Loop:
Starts in Newport on the Idaho-Washington border 60 miles northeast of Spokane.
Length of drive:
144 mile (231.7 km) loop
Suggested driving time:
6 + hours
Road Type:
Paved
Best time of year for visiting:
Drivable Year round
